[QUOTE="snullia, post: 385504, member: 25406"] Jeb - excellent info I did change the bearings on my 02 exc520 this last weekend. These instructions sure would have been nice to have then. "Set radial play on rocker arms before tigtening the rocker box cover ...." I have not heard about this adjustment before. Do you consider this adjustment necessary on a newer bike or is this something to worry about with time/wear. It was possible to perform the work without removing the camshaft from the head. A little fineness required though.... The standard TAIWAN bearings were of type C3. I thought they were using some better quality bearings for the ´02 models. In went some SKF C3 bearings....
